WebFeb 24, 2016 · A /23 block contains 512 addresses. 2^(32-23)=512. You can use them to make any number of subnets that you want. For example: 2 subnets of 256 addresses (254 hosts, 1 for subnet and one for broadcast) 4 subnets of 128 addresses (126 hosts, 1 for subnet and one for broadcast) 8 subnets of 64 addresses (62 hosts, 1 for subnet and one …

WebApr 8, 2024 · In those cases, a /23 or /22 subnet may be more appropriate. The decimal subnet mask for a /23 is 255.255.254.0. With it, you can get a single VLAN with 512 IP addresses. The decimal subnet mask for a /22 is 255.255.252.0 and … WebDec 27, 2024 · The subnet mask 255.255.255.192 gives you four networks of 62 hosts each. It works because in binary notation, 255.255.255.192 is the same as 1111111.11111111.1111111.11000000. The first two digits of the last octet become network addresses, so you get the additional networks 00000000 (0), 01000000 (64), …
